I copied Conflict: Desert Storm II to the xbox HD and when I try to play it, I get the dirty/damaged disc error. I've already backed up a few other games and they play flawlessly. I used the DVD2Xbox that came w/Slayer's 2.5. I read somewhere else that changing from 50mhz to 60mhz in M$Dash can fix this... is this correct? If so how do I do it? Is there anything else I can do? DVD2Xbox said all files copied fine...

ok. To change your XBOX Video settings you must BOOT the NORMAL M$ DASHBOARD...

Under evox its called M$ Dashboard.

Once it loads your standard xbox dashboard up you should select 'settings' and then choose 'video'..

Now right in front of you it will display all the video modes including widesceen 16:9 50mhz/60mhz etc.. Just pick what you want and reboot your xbox..
